View Top Employees for Arterial Network
img Website arterialnetwork.org
img Industry Arts And Crafts
img Location Cape Town, Western Cape, South Africa
img Employees 19
img Founded 2007
img Website arterialnetwork.org
img Industry Arts And Crafts
img Location Cape Town, Western Cape, South Africa
img Employees 19
img Founded 2007
img LinkedIn linkedin.com/company/arterial-network

Top Arterial Network Employees